The Programmer/Analyst’s role at VSAC is to define, analyze, develop and test new and existing software applications that meet VSAC’s business requirements.
Responsibilities include:
• Collaborate with business users and other team members throughout the development lifecycle.
• Research emerging application development products, languages, and standards.
• Follow and support best practices for developing applications according to specifications
• Enhance functionality and/or performance of existing company applications
Requirements include:
• Degree or certificate in computer science, web development or software engineering with 3+ years of related experience
• Excellent understanding of coding methods and best practices
• Strong Web application development experience, full stack preferred
• Team player who can work effectively as part of a multidisciplinary team
• Solid testing, troubleshooting and problem-solving skills
• Excellent verbal and written communication skills
Technologies used at VSAC:
• Relational Databases; DB2, MS SQL Server, MySQL, MS Access
• HTML/CSS/JavaScript/jQuery/TypeScript
• Object Relational Mapping (ORM)
• Squirrel SQL Client
• Languages include Java 8+, Python, Grails and Struts frameworks
• Apache Tomcat
• Spring Boot, SOAP – Apache CXF, REST-JSON, IntelliJ IDEA
• WAMP Server, Windows Server 2016
• Gradle, Maven
